**2026-05-07** — Phase 14 record parser: `data Foo = Foo { name :: T, … }`:
- Extended `hk-parse-con-def` to peek for `{` after the constructor name; if
found, parse `varid :: type` pairs separated by commas, terminate with `}`,
return `(:con-rec name [(fname ftype) …])`. Positional constructors fall
through to the existing `:con-def` path. Verified record parses; no
regressions in parse.sx (43/43), parser-decls (24/24), deriving (15/15).
